I am working on finding the relationship between FDI inflow and military expenditure. I have panel data of 62 developing countries from 1990 to 2018. These countries are divided into five geographical regions. I was wondering if I could cluster my errors to the geographical regions instead of clustering by country. Wikipedia article mentions that 30-50 clusters are preferred but I could not see a particular reason behind this.
